Original U.S. Springfield Trapdoor Model 1873 Rifle made in 1879 Updated to Model 1888 - Serial No 111062 Japanese Marines if you have a preferenceOriginal Item: Only One available. The U. S. breech loading Springfield "trapdoor" rifle was introduced in 1873 in . 45 70 caliber. Basically it was the rifle the U. S. Army used to open the West and Springfield trapdoor carbines were used by Custer's Cavalry at the massacre at The Little Big Horn. This example has the breech block marking: U. S.
